Transaction 7f161c8bde8652c7a59efd8ad0428b5d23bfd7b057bef4df3e890008cd921be7

1 Input
1 Outputs
  • 7f161c8bde8652c7a59efd8ad0428b5d23bfd7b057bef4df3e890008cd921be7:0
  • value  644217
    address  3KeaXjhEfHrNdcQWp8ZyFgyzD7fQ7QoXMt